Shannon, If you have not been to see your surgeon in a while I would suggest you do that and get checked out. I feel that it is unusual for someone that is 4 years out not to be hungry, there could be something else going on.
If all is well then I would suggest going back to basics to get back into the losing mode, 10lbs is a good start. I would ask you if you are following the rules we were taught as new post ops. Not drinking with meals, eat protien first then vegetables and fruit and whole grain foods. You might try eating small meals every 3 hours or so during the day and see if that helps. You need to eat healthy to stay healthy and you are too young to stop taking care of yourself.
